The Annual Life AuditOne of the most powerful journaling exercises to undertake on your birthday is the annual life audit. This process involves taking a comprehensive look at various dimensions of your life, such as career, relationships, health, and personal growth. Start by identifying what went well over the previous twelve months and acknowledge the milestones you achieved, no matter how small they may seem. Then, honestly assess the areas where you feel stuck or unfulfilled. Write about the lessons you learned from your challenges and how those experiences have shaped your character. This structured evaluation helps clear mental clutter and provides a solid foundation for designing the upcoming year.
The Birthday Time CapsuleCreating a birthday time capsule in your journal is a fun and highly engaging exercise that you will cherish looking back on in the future. Dedicate a few pages to record the current facts of your life, painting a vivid picture of exactly who you are at this specific age. Include your current favorite books, songs, movies, and foods. Write down your daily routine, your current occupation, and the people who are closest to you. You can also document the current trends in the world, the places you have traveled to recently, and the goals you are actively pursuing. Sealing these memories on paper creates a nostalgic snapshot that perfectly captures the essence of your life at this exact moment in time.
Letter to Your Future SelfWriting a letter to your future self is a classic birthday tradition that bridges the gap between who you are today and who you hope to become. Address the letter to yourself for a milestone age, such as five or ten years in the future. In this letter, express your current hopes, dreams, and deepest desires. Share the wisdom you have gathered so far and offer words of encouragement for the obstacles you might face down the road. Seal the letter and make a commitment to yourself to only open it on the specific birthday you chose. This practice fosters a strong sense of hope and continuity, reminding you to stay aligned with your core values as you journey through life.
The Future-Self Vision BoardWhile vision boards are often created using poster board and magazine cutouts, you can easily translate this concept into a written journaling exercise. Dedicate a section of your journal to vividly describe your ideal future over the next year, five years, or even a decade. Write about your ultimate aspirations in the present tense, as if they have already happened. Detail the emotions you feel, the environments you are in, and the people who surround you. By articulating your dreams with sensory details, you anchor them in your subconscious mind and make them feel tangible. This imaginative practice transforms abstract wishes into concrete goals you can actively work toward.
Cultivating an Attitude of GratitudeA birthday is the perfect time to shift your focus toward gratitude and appreciation. In your journal, create an extensive list of the people, experiences, and things you are grateful for as you step into a new year. Reflect on the relationships that bring you joy, the opportunities that have allowed you to grow, and the simple everyday pleasures that make life beautiful. Writing down your blessings cultivates a positive mindset and sets a joyful tone for the upcoming year. This practice of thankfulness helps to ground you, ensuring that you appreciate the present moment while eagerly anticipating the adventures that lie ahead.
